Description
Set against a velvety black ground, this vessel becomes a nocturnal stage where white, river-like bands guide the eye in a slow, ceremonial procession around the form. The spare, lyrical figures—musicians, dancers, and small birds—are rendered as symbols rather than portraits, suggesting a communal memory carried through rhythm and ritual rather than words. Subtle red rings near the rim act like distant horizons, quietly warming the composition and anchoring its narrative between earthbound celebration and an imagined, protective sky. The curvature of the pot turns the scene into a continuous cycle, inviting the viewer to “read” culture as something that moves, repeats, and endures.
